Wake County’s Solid Waste Management Division will hold a free screening of the documentary ‘Refabricate’ at Marbles Kids Museum on November 18, 2025, at 6 p.m. The event is intended to inform the public about the environmental effects of clothing disposal. Each year, about 257 tons of clothing are dropped off at local convenience centers. Commissioner Safiyah Jackson said sustainability should be considered as fast-fashion trends increase.
‘Refabricate’ is a short film about sustainable fashion in the Triangle area. It includes interviews with researchers, entrepreneurs, and designers. The screening will be in the Zanzibar A room.
